Spring fishing brings out one of the most heated debates in angling—what line actually gives you the edge. In this episode of All Eyes on Fishing, we break down the great line debate: braid, fluorocarbon, or monofilament. When does each shine? When does it hurt you? And what are serious anglers really running when the bite gets tough? We dig into real-world experience, spring conditions, and the small details that can make the difference between a limit and a long day. If you’ve ever questioned what should be tied to your reel this time of year, this is the conversation.
